// WebSocket client for the Fluxgate relay.
// permessage-deflate is DISABLED here on purpose: compression on
// attacker-influenced frames risks CRIME-style leakage, and our
// payloads are small JSON anyway, so the bandwidth win is ~8%.
// Security review: flag any PR that re-enables it.
// The client authenticates to the internal relay with the key below.

API key for tagug-tajef: vxb4-R1fo

Ticket: VRAMscope creds expired again

The token our GPU memory profiler VRAMscope uses to ship heap snapshots to the Gradelock ingest service lapsed overnight, so last night's profiling run is empty. Could you sanity-check the scopes before we re-enable it? Read-only ingest should be enough. The freshly issued replacement key is below.

gateway credential: kto23_LX9A4ys6i4nzHtpOLNLodKK

Welcome to the PedalShuffle team! This tool figures out which docks in the Marrowvale bike-share network are overflowing and dispatches rebalancing vans accordingly. Most of the logic lives in the planner module — don't touch the solver unless you really mean it. To run locally, you'll need access to the DockPulse internal API. Use the key below for staging only.

app token of hahag-kafog = qvz7-KHpOyEw

## Runbook: TaxTrellis rate-lookup cache

If lookups return stale rates, flush the TaxTrellis cache shard for the affected region, then trigger a warm-fill from the rates service. Do not flush all shards at once; the rates service rate-limits hard. Confirm recovery via the staleness dashboard. Log the flush with the build token shown below.

build token for kagaf-hahof: htk14_9d3d4d26d7d8de